Understanding the Physics of Plinko and Probability

The core mechanic of plinko revolves around the unpredictable nature of bouncing. Each peg acts as a point of deflection, sending the puck either left or right. While each deflection appears random, the underlying probabilities are actually quite consistent. Assuming the pegs are evenly spaced and the puck behaves predictably (no unusual spin or external forces), the puck has roughly a 50/50 chance of deflecting left or right at each peg. However, this simple binary choice creates a complex web of possibilities as the puck descends, making it impossible to predict the exact landing spot with certainty. Therefore, a key aspect of maximizing winnings involves understanding these probabilities and recognizing that the more pegs the puck interacts with, the closer the outcome becomes to a uniform distribution across all the prize slots.

The Impact of Peg Configuration

The arrangement of pegs significantly influences the payout distribution. A wider board with more pegs generally leads to a more even spread of outcomes, reducing the volatility but also potentially capping the maximum winnings. Conversely, a narrower board with fewer pegs can result in higher volatility, offering the chance for substantial payouts but also increasing the risk of landing in lower-value slots. Analyzing the peg configuration is the first step in devising a strategy for a specific plinko board. Furthermore, slight variations in peg placement or angle can introduce subtle biases that experienced players might exploit.

To quantify these probabilities, consider a simplified scenario with a single row of pegs. If the puck hits five pegs, there are 32 possible paths (2^5). Each path has an equal probability of occurring. As the board gets more complex, the number of possible paths increases exponentially. While calculating every single path becomes impractical, understanding the principles of exponential growth and probability distributions allows players to make informed decisions about their starting position. The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)

Modern plinko games, particularly those found online, rely on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ure fairness and unpredictability. RNGs are sophisticated algorithms that produce sequences of numbers that appear random. These numbers determine the puck's trajectory and ultimately its landing spot. Reputable online casinos employ RNGs that are independently tested and certified to guarantee their impartiality. Understanding the role of RNGs is essential for appreciating the fairness of modern plinko games. The RNG ensures that each game is independent of previous results, meaning past outcomes have no bearing on future ones.
